Obviously I`m not gonna clay it, but do you guys think that I even need the AIO?? I mean, isnt AIO mainly for cleaning and removing oxidation?? How does the paint feel? Even new cars from the showroom still need claying sometimes.



AIO is a good prep for applying SG. It may not be necessary, but will clean off oils and stuff that might get in the way of SG. I`d use it at least once since you have it anyway.

What 4DSC said. The car has probably been transported by rail and truck, and may indeed have more contaminants than you realize. You might try claying one small section, then compare the "feel" of it to the others. I`ve been amazed that, even when I thought my paint was "perfect," it got even "perfecter" :D after claying.

Yeah, either clay or ABC it. If you get rust-blooms (from ferrous contaminants) on silver it`s a pain to deal with. By the time you see them the damage is done.
